Output 83b109199c4ac76f38de7a8ac8c47f91dc2c45cfe48843cdcc07c992b19f946b:1

value
11457700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b8360572a89a14559d03f0692a5399512f60728 OP_EQUAL
address
377hB3oitZSqiPp6jTwHUtfJGAGurDgyiK
transaction
83b109199c4ac76f38de7a8ac8c47f91dc2c45cfe48843cdcc07c992b19f946b
confirmations
475480
spent
true